Part of Cambridge's Cavendish Laboratory, CORDE enables university and industry researchers to access facilities and expertise unique to Cambridge.
🔬 After coating the wafer with resist, it’s time to transfer the design into the photosensitive film. Here we see a resist-coated wafer being mounted and loaded into the VB6 Electron Beam Lithography tool ahead of the process.

🧪Lithography is a crucial step in any micro or nanofabrication process. It’s how patterns from a design are precisely transferred onto a chip or wafer. Here, we capture the spin-coating of a resist film onto a 150mm wafer.

From chip-scale experiments to wafer-level innovation💫
Our new Nanofabrication Cleanrooms at the Ray Dolby Centre are equipped to support it all.
Here, a researcher runs a 200 mm wafer through the Oxford Instruments ICPCVD tool - used to deposit uniform, dielectric films onto wafers and chips.

New paper out: Surface visualisation of bacterial biofilms using neutral helium microscopy.
Led by Royal Society Wolfson Visiting Fellow Prof. Paul Dastoor with the CORDE Characterisation team, this international collaboration used the UK’s only SHeM to image biofilms — no coating, no damage.

At CORDE's #AtomScattering and #AtomMicroscopy Facility, we’re pushing the boundaries of what’s possible✨

Using helium atom scattering the researchers can carry out ultra-sensitive structural and dynamic analysis of 2D materials and surfaces.
